Transaction 58f55f2a0f53a8ef260650847a83fa661fb50461ab5c1d31beab96ef4a896c8b

1 Input
2 Outputs
  • 58f55f2a0f53a8ef260650847a83fa661fb50461ab5c1d31beab96ef4a896c8b:0
  • value  32877163
    address  15bUg9skLuic9W5jicmZjpEk6GmXHSiyDi
  • 58f55f2a0f53a8ef260650847a83fa661fb50461ab5c1d31beab96ef4a896c8b:1
  • value  592889
    address  16fU5Dg4NuhJhJLkfVFk5NfuiqPDjA9Sk5